So Lizabreff, Curdy and I decided to have another virtual Korean Movie Night, because the last one worked out so well. It was fun, but we opted out for a romantic comedy this time, so we went with On Your Wedding Day. It was hilarious. Just all around solid writing and acting. It's told from the perspective of present day (or wedding day) Woo Yeon (Kim Young Kwang) who is a P.E. teacher telling his students about his first love story with Seung Hee (Park Bo Young) which starts back in high school and then progresses through college, etc., to the present. It's very slice of life with just that chill and ridiculous comedy that comes from the relatable, especially when it's being told from the perspective of one of those people who is an embellisher.
It was very well written and acted. Basically this part was written for Kim Young Kwang and you can't help but fall for his grin and puppy-like energy and devotion. And of course Park Bo Young is just perfect. I love her nuanced acting, especially since the movie is told from his point of view, but we could see tell what was going on with her (even when his character couldn't), and she ugly cries like a real person, props! They had good chemistry and were just one of the cutest couples ever, even as we were laughing about their height difference. The ensemble was good too, because how can you get better than Kang Ki Young as a best friend? You cannot. The group of college boys in the boarding house were just hilarious and perfectly awkward. Best of all was the natural progression. It had excellent pacing and narration, so everything that happened made sense and I felt at peace with all the choices. I really don't think I would change a thing or complain about anything, no matter what complicated feelings I feel. It was hilarious, cute, sweet, and lovely. I recommend it.

214. Squad 38 38사기동대 (2016) Korean
Ma Dong Seok, Seo In Guk, Sooyoung, Song Ok Suk, Heo Jae Ho, Ko Kyu Pil, Lee Sun Bin
Drama Rating: 8/10 Neck Score: A
As a heisty type drama, this was pretty good. I think that might have been like 75% because of Seo In Guk and Ma Dong Seok, who are both amazing. It had some slow parts and the habit of you being super angry at the villains because they were the scum of the earth, but I guess that made it super satisfying at the end when they were gotten. I was really busy when I finished this, so it's actually been too long since I've watched it for me to actually remember my impressions of it. But it was so good that Curdy had to watch it with us. That is saying a lot. But she was hooked from the start and made more excited noises while watching than I did. I loved all of the main characters. Literally I only hated the villains, and each villain was worst than the last. Then there were the lukewarm villains, the lackeys who did all the dirty work. I loved how you hated them, but it was also complicated. You could be sympathetic to them occasionally. That's good writing. I liked most of the twists they had, and the "surprise, you've been hustled" moments for the most part made sense, which is important. I do need to write a post about the nicknames for this show, because everyone had one. That's how endearing the characters were. Loved it.
